As You Were, Says FIFA

Posted: 03 Mar 2011 10:35 AM PST

Jack-Warner-001

FIFA rolled out the changes in typical FIFA fashion today: there are none.

The possibility for a shuffle of allocated spots at the 2014 World Cup in Brazil was opened to the floor and CONCACAF, led by the all-powerful Jack Warner, steamed into town requesting another spot at the expense of…someone. Likely Africa.

No such luck.

What’s astounding isn’t the fact that there are no change, but rather that a group led by Jack Warner within the confines of FIFA wanted something and yet didn’t get it.

Charting new waters here.

The usual suspects:

Europe will keep its 13 places—considered too many by some observers—while Africa will have five, Asia 4.5, CONCACAF 3.5 and Oceania 0.5. South American will have 4.5 places, not including Brazil.

Based on footballing clout alone, not nations/federations or population, it’s rather staggering to think Africa has more World Cup spots than South America, isn’t it?

Sounds like they have a much bigger gripe than CONCACAF.

Polkraine 2012: Standing Atop Special Stands

Posted: 24 Feb 2011 12:15 PM PST

b023d1fd4e1d34f7c7298bfa9591326d,14,1

Of all the many things accounted for in the bid for Polkraine 2012, they probably didn’t include having to consider, or being asked for, a stand exclusively for gay and lesbian football fans.

That’s changing. A movement of sorts has erupted in Poland to allow a gay fan club their own special stand at Polkraine 2012.


But other gay rights activists criticized the proposal Wednesday, saying it would single gay fans out and put them at greater risk.

Teczowa Trybuna 2012, or Rainbow Stand 2012, calls itself the first gay fan club for Poland's national team. It says on its website that its members fear aggression from other fans and want to feel safe during the championship in Poland and neighboring Ukraine.

"During trips to matches of our beloved clubs … we unfortunately are often faced with unpleasantness, harassment and violence from the 'real' fans," it said. "We dream of being able to relax in the stands—we can't imagine not being at the Euro 2012 matches, which will be held in our country!"

Hardly the biggest story to come out of building up to Polkraine 2012 – that belongs to those unfounded rumbling which precede every major tournament: will it happen? – but it’s certainly one of the more intriguing ones. There are points to each side, but the chances that it happens are ultimately slim – the precedent would be too great and possibly too easily manipulated in the future. First sexual orientation, then religion, then milk preference (1%, skim, whole, etc). Where would it all end?

Very unfortunate they think it necessary, though.

Ronaldo Given Fish In A Barrel For His Selecao Sendoff

Posted: 16 Feb 2011 10:00 AM PST

ronaldo

Ask and you shall receive.

Well, so long as you’re one of the greatest players to have ever graced a football pitch with your otherworldly abilities.

Ronaldo asked the Brazilian federation for a sendoff friendly with the Selecao, and they have obliged with one of the most lopsided games in football history: the 2002 World Cup-winning Brazilian side versus a gaggle of local Chechnyans, including the President.

Brazil's 2002 World Cup-winning team will play a friendly next month in the formerly wartorn Russian province of Chechnya, a local official said Wednesday.

Chechnya's government website cited sports minister Haidar Alkhanov as saying Kaka, Ronaldinho and the recently retired Ronaldo are likely to feature in the March 10 match. Chechnya president Ramzan Kadyrov will captain a team comprising local players.

There was no word of confirmation from Brazilian officials, but if the match goes ahead it will be the third major football coup in a month for Russia's poverty-stricken Caucasus region, which is better known for separatist violence than sport.

(It should be noted those ‘local’ players may actually be Russian Premier League side Terek Grozny; not quite as lopsided, but still wouldn’t keep anything on the table.)

No word if he’ll be bringing back that fly hair for the occasion, but it should be absolute mandatory. That and an over/under in triple figures.
